When and how to collect pollen

The collection of pine pollen is organized during the flowering period of the plant. Although it is not entirely legitimate to call this process flowering. In botany, those formations that appear at the ends of pine branches in the spring are called microstrobilae or male cones. Male spores mature in them.

Pine pollen is nothing more than mature male sporangia necessary for pollination female gametes, which leads to the development of cones on the tree. The structure of this unusual formation is such that the wind can carry it thousands of kilometers from the source. Air samples taken high in the mountains showed that pine pollen was present in significant quantities there too.

In central Russia, the period when pine pollen is formed occurs at the beginning of May. To the north and east of the central regions, flowering dates may be shifted by a couple of weeks, depending on weather conditions. Flowering lasts only 1-2 days, so it is recommended to first collect material on the edges and southern slopes, and then only go into the shade of the forest. In this way, the collection period can be extended.

In Siberia, in addition to pine, cedar blooms during the same period. Cedar pollen is an analogue of pine pollen, with some variations in the content of resins, essential oils and the percentage of vitamins.

The main sign by which it is determined whether the pollen is ready is the color of the inflorescence. If the tips of the pine branches have acquired a bright yellow-green hue, then you can start collecting. The inflorescences are cut off and carefully placed on clean thick paper. Then the material is transferred to a dry, warm place without drafts. Pine pollen is very volatile, the slightest movement of air will blow away the entire collected material. Hence the main condition: it should be collected only in calm, windless, dry weather.

After drying, pine pollen requires sieving; it must be separated from the scales and folded into a thick paper bag. Fabric bags are absolutely not suitable as a way to store any material with a fine texture. It is also not recommended to use plastic containers for storage, as the drug may become damp.

How to properly prepare raw materials

Self-harvesting pine pollen at home is done during flowering, when the male flower cones become yellow(from approximately May 10). At the first stage, they are green, and when pressed, liquid comes out of them - this means that it is too early to collect them. When the color changes to yellow, there are only 1-2 days when the liquid is no longer released and the pollen has not yet flown out.

At the second stage, the cones need to be dried - place them in a warm and dry room without drafts in a thin layer on paper. After drying, the pollen will freely fall out of the strobila. The easiest way to sow the healing mass is with a fine sieve with a plastic bag attached to the bottom. The finished pollen is sent for storage - it can be placed in plastic bottles and left in a dry, cool place under tightly closed lids. Properly collected and dried pollen has no expiration date.

We collect and store correctly

Male pine inflorescences are collected - in other words, stamens or anthers. It is important not to rush and not to be late. The scales of unripe stamens are closed and release milky juice when pressed. Overripe anthers are dry and empty - the pollen from them has already flown away to pollinate female flowers, and you will not get anything.

Choose a clear and preferably calm day to collect pollen. You can simply shake out the pollen from the inflorescences into prepared liter jars. But it is better to collect the anthers entirely - this way there are fewer losses and more benefits. Select yellow, dense, full of pollen stamens. Then they will need to be dried in a dry and necessarily closed room - the slightest draft can steal your precious loot.

Pine pollen is a precious preparation for the winter

When the dried stamens open, all that remains is to carefully shake out the pollen from them into sterile glass jars or bags on a “string” - this is very convenient. You need to store pine pollen in tightly closed containers to prevent moisture or curious boogers from getting in there that might want to eat it or also get some treatment!
